2025 CNS Summit Series: Rewriting the Rules of Neurodegeneration, A Conversation with Arvinas CSO Angela Cacace, PhD
What if protein degradation could address neurodegenerative diseases, not just cancer?
In this episode, Dr. Angela Cacace, CSO at Arvinas, speaks with Dr. Talar Hopyan, Global Head of CST at Syneos Health, about how the company is advancing a degrader targeting LRRK2 in Parkinson’s disease and why early-stage signals in healthy volunteers are raising new possibilities for CNS care.
They discuss how Arvinas is engineering blood-brain barrier-penetrant molecules, the translational challenges in neurodegeneration and what’s required to move from platform to patient.
What you’ll learn:
- How Arvinas is expanding targeted protein degradation into neurology
- Why LRRK2 degradation is a promising approach for Parkinson’s disease
- What it takes to translate platform innovation into measurable clinical outcomes
